Florida vacation travel planing: transportation for your Key West vacation

Learn the best ways to get around on your Key West vacation. Less stress and hassle...

Key West, Florida is the southernmost point in the continental United States. It offers a unique perspective of life. It's laid back atmosphere is exhilarating to some. On Key West, Florida, you can experience night life and the fun and sun of some gorgeous beaches all at the same time. Here are the best ways to get around on Key West, Florida.

• Foot. This is the most affordable way to get around on Key West. The island is fairly small. You probably don't want to try walking all the way around the island, but you could if you wanted. But all you really need is access to your hotel, the beach, and the downtown area. If you are within walking distance of these places, why rent a car or bike?

• Bicycle. This is how most people transport themselves on the island. If you're flying into Key West, you may want to just rent a couple bicycles for your group. They aren't all that expensive... and are rented on a daily basis. With a bicycle, you can ride around to all the different sights on the island, and have a mode of transportation that is safe and fun.And you can get plenty of exercise while you're at it. This is probably the most popular way of getting around on Key West.

• Car. There are several places to rent a car on Key West, primarily at the airport. The traditional companies here will rent you a car by the day, week, or however many days you need it for. You want to be sure to place your reservations for the car well in advance, because cars are popular to rent on the island. Of course, if you drive yourself to Key West, it likely will be a long haul, but you'll be able to experience all of the Florida keys during your trek to the westernmost island in Florida

• Taxi. This can get expensive, but because the island is so small might be worth the cost. If you just need to make a few journeys across the island on your trip to Key West, this might just be the best way to go. If you think you'll spend most of your time on the beach or in places that are within walking distance, why not just hail a cab when you need one?
